Well, they can't. The request has to be approved by a Support member. They only approve it if the winner accepts a reroll, they aren't accepting the gift in a week or if the user has a reason to get suspended/was recently suspended. Not all of my tickets got rerolls because the winners had already been banned for the rules they broke before, that means I had to send them their game.

For people who make a lot of giveaways, especially public ones this feature comes quite in handy sometimes when you want to re-roll on a rule-breaker or on someone who already owns the game, maybe sometimes winner changes their mind and asks for a reroll. I've done that once, decided I wouldn't play the game after all so I asked the giveaway maker to re-roll and give it to someone else who would hopefully play it.
